From 98c567fe6f065789dc724eca25436651cc84d879 Mon Sep 17 00:00:00 2001 From: Florian Schmidt Date: Wed, 9 Aug 2023 01:35:15 +0200 Subject: [PATCH] Use correct seed on api world load (#9541) --- ...0-Use-correct-seed-on-api-world-load.patch | 19 +++++++++++++++++++ 1 file changed, 19 insertions(+) create mode 100644 patches/server/1000-Use-correct-seed-on-api-world-load.patch diff --git a/patches/server/1000-Use-correct-seed-on-api-world-load.patch b/patches/server/1000-Use-correct-seed-on-api-world-load.patch new file mode 100644 index 0000000000..9d1369ecae --- /dev/null +++ b/patches/server/1000-Use-correct-seed-on-api-world-load.patch @@ -0,0 +1,19 @@ +From 0000000000000000000000000000000000000000 Mon Sep 17 00:00:00 2001 +From: Florian Schmidt +Date: Fri, 28 Jul 2023 14:14:35 +0200 +Subject: [PATCH] Use correct seed on api world load + + +diff --git a/src/main/java/org/bukkit/craftbukkit/CraftServer.java b/src/main/java/org/bukkit/craftbukkit/CraftServer.java +index 54f27d91f941235a99e341ed84531ad7f0840728..249d76acac9a91cd46f0b8a477511974a75d6f4a 100644 +--- a/src/main/java/org/bukkit/craftbukkit/CraftServer.java ++++ b/src/main/java/org/bukkit/craftbukkit/CraftServer.java +@@ -1330,7 +1330,7 @@ public final class CraftServer implements Server { + + // Paper - move down + +- long j = BiomeManager.obfuscateSeed(creator.seed()); ++ long j = BiomeManager.obfuscateSeed(worlddata.worldGenOptions().seed()); // Paper - use world seed + List list = ImmutableList.of(new PhantomSpawner(), new PatrolSpawner(), new CatSpawner(), new VillageSiege(), new WanderingTraderSpawner(worlddata)); + LevelStem worlddimension = iregistry.get(actualDimension); +